What is National Income and How to Calculate it Using the Income Approach?
National Income (NI) represents the total earnings of a country’s residents from the production of goods and services over a specific period, typically a year. It is a vital macroeconomic indicator used to gauge a nation’s economic health and standard of living. The method to how to calculate national income using the income approach involves summing up all the incomes earned by the factors of production: labor, capital, land, and entrepreneurship. This approach provides a clear picture of how income is distributed among the population. Economists, policymakers, and investors rely on this data to make informed decisions. A common misconception is confusing National Income with Gross Domestic Product (GDP). While related, they are different; the income approach focuses on earnings, whereas the expenditure approach (used for GDP) focuses on spending. The Formula and Mathematical Explanation for the Income Approach
The core of learning how to calculate national income using the income approach lies in its straightforward formula. You aggregate all pre-tax incomes earned by individuals and corporations within a country. The formula is as follows:
NI = Compensation of Employees + Rental & Royalty Income + Net Interest + Proprietors' Income + Corporate Profits
This calculation provides a comprehensive view of the earnings generated across the economy. Each component represents a unique stream of income paid to a factor of production. Mastering how to calculate national income using the income approach requires understanding each of these variables.
| Variable | Meaning | Unit | Typical Range |
|---|---|---|---|
| Compensation of Employees | All wages, salaries, and benefits paid to workers. | Currency (e.g., Billions of $) | 50-70% of NI |
| Rental & Royalty Income | Income from property, patents, and copyrights. | Currency (e.g., Billions of $) | 1-5% of NI |
| Net Interest | Interest income received by individuals, minus interest paid. | Currency (e.g., Billions of $) | 2-8% of NI |
| Proprietors’ Income | Income of non-corporate businesses (e.g., sole proprietorships). | Currency (e.g., Billions of $) | 5-10% of NI |
| Corporate Profits | Profits of corporations before tax. | Currency (e.g., Billions of $) | 10-20% of NI |
Practical Examples of Calculating National Income
To better illustrate how to calculate national income using the income approach, let’s consider two real-world scenarios.
Example 1: A Developed Economy
Imagine a country with high wage levels and significant corporate activity. The inputs might be:
- Compensation of Employees: $7,000 billion
- Rental & Royalty Income: $400 billion
- Net Interest: $600 billion
- Proprietors’ Income: $900 billion
- Corporate Profits: $2,100 billion
Using the formula, the National Income is: $7000 + $400 + $600 + $900 + $2100 = $11,000 billion. This result indicates a robust economy where labor compensation forms the largest share, a key insight from learning how to calculate national income using the income approach. Example 2: A Developing Economy
In a smaller, developing economy, the figures might look different:
- Compensation of Employees: $200 billion
- Rental & Royalty Income: $20 billion
- Net Interest: $30 billion
- Proprietors’ Income: $80 billion
- Corporate Profits: $70 billion
The National Income is: $200 + $20 + $30 + $80 + $70 = $400 billion. Here, proprietors’ income and wages make up a substantial portion, reflecting a different economic structure. This example further clarifies the practical application of how to calculate national income using the income approach.

Key Factors That Affect National Income Results
Several economic factors can influence the components of national income. Understanding them is part of truly knowing how to calculate national income using the income approach. Here are six key factors:
- Labor Market Conditions: High employment rates and wage growth directly increase the Compensation of Employees, boosting national income.
- Corporate Profitability: The health of the corporate sector determines profits. Strong earnings, driven by innovation and demand, raise the Corporate Profits component. Exploring the expenditure vs income approach can provide more context on this.
- Interest Rate Environment: Monetary policy set by central banks affects the Net Interest component. Higher interest rates can increase interest income for savers.
- Entrepreneurial Activity: The prevalence of small businesses and self-employment directly impacts Proprietors’ Income. A thriving entrepreneurial ecosystem is vital for this component.
- Real Estate and Asset Markets: The performance of the property market influences Rental Income. A booming market will increase this value, affecting the overall calculation.
- Government Policies: Tax laws, subsidies, and regulations can impact corporate profits and proprietors’ income, thereby indirectly influencing the national income figures. Frequently Asked Questions (FAQ)
1. What is the main difference between the income approach and the expenditure approach?
The income approach sums all incomes earned (wages, profits, rent, interest), while the expenditure approach sums all spending on final goods and services (consumption, investment, government spending, net exports). Both should theoretically yield the same result, but discrepancies can arise due to data collection issues.
2. Why are transfer payments like social security excluded?
Transfer payments are excluded because they are not payments for current productive services. They are a redistribution of existing income, so including them would result in double-counting and an inflated national income figure. This is a key principle when you calculate national income using the income approach.
3. Is proprietors’ income the same as profit?
No. Proprietors’ income is the earnings of unincorporated businesses, which includes both the owner’s labor and their return on investment. Corporate profit is the earnings of incorporated businesses only.
4. What are the limitations of the income approach?
The main limitation is the potential for underreporting income, especially from the informal or “black” economy. It can be difficult to accurately track all sources of income, leading to figures that may be lower than the actual economic activity.
5. How does this differ from Gross Domestic Product (GDP)?
National Income (NI) is the total income of a country’s residents, regardless of where it was earned. GDP is the total value of production within a country’s borders, regardless of who owns the factors of production. 7. Why is ‘Net Interest’ used instead of total interest?
Net interest is used to avoid double counting. It represents the interest received by households and government minus the interest paid by them. Interest payments from one firm to another are considered an intermediate cost and are already part of profits.
8. Does inflation affect this calculation?
